This position is eligible for the Education Debt Reduction Program (EDRP), a student loan payment reimbursement program. You must meet specific individual eligibility requirements in accordance with VHA policy and submit your EDRP application within four months of appointment. Program Approval, award amount (up to $200,000) and eligibility period (one to five years) are determined by the VHA Education Loan Repayment Services program office after complete review of the EDRP application.

Provide psychotherapy for individuals, groups, couples, and families with evidence-based approaches such as Prolonged Exposure, Cognitive Processing Therapy, Written Exposure Therapy, and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ing, among other proven PTSD interventions. Collaborate with the multidisciplinary team to develop personalized treatment plans, adjusting strategies using Measurement-Based Care principles. Handle crisis intervention and suicide prevention, addressing urgent mental health needs as they arise. Monitor patient progress, revise treatment plans as needed, document clinical services, and ensure timely completion of required charting within Federal Electronic Health Record. Offer expert consultation to medical center staff and community providers on assessments, treatment options, behavior management, and coordinating care. Join multidisciplinary team meetings to assist with case formulations, treatment planning, and program effectiveness reviews. Foster a therapeutic environment in the RRTP by promoting recovery-oriented care and supporting trauma-informed practices among staff. Provide training and supervision for psychology trainees, interns, residents, and other healthcare learners within licensure and privilege constraints. Coordinate referrals to specialty programs, community resources, and interdisciplinary teams to support veterans' recovery and reintegration. Participate in administrative duties such as workload entry, attending staff meetings, mandatory trainings, and quality improvement initiatives. May also take part in research or program evaluation activities, following VA policies and obtaining necessary approval from service leadership. Parental Leave: After 12 months of employment, up to 12 weeks of paid parental leave in connection with the birth, adoption, or foster care placement of a child. Child Care Subsidy: After 60 days of employment, full time employees with a total family income below $144,000 may be eligible for a childcare subsidy up to 25% of total eligible childcare costs for eligible children up to the monthly maximum of $416.66.
